Spider Control in Fort Lawn, South Carolina

Home / Pest Control / South Carolina / Spider Control in Fort Lawn, South Carolina


0 /5

0 Reviews

Fort Lawn Animal Clinic is a well-respected veterinary clinic located in Fort Lawn, South Carolina. Serving the community for several years, the clinic is known for providing compassionate and high-qu